‘Donkey Kong Bananza’ Hailed as “Amazing” on Nintendo Switch 2
Updated June 18, 2025
Nintendo Switch 2 owners are expressing excitement over “Donkey Kong Bananza,” a new 3D platformer after Nintendo showcased the game. The Nintendo Switch 2 was released last month with “Mario Kart World.”
The company previewed “Donkey Kong Bananza” in a 15-minute Direct presentation, generating buzz among fans. The game, slated for a July 17 release, unites Donkey Kong with Pauline, who appeared in the original “Donkey Kong” and later in “Super Mario Odyssey.”
Together, they confront the Void Company, which seeks to exploit Ingot Isle’s resources. Pauline, an aspiring singer, empowers Donkey kong with musical transformations, granting him unique abilities like super strength, speed, and flight.
Donkey Kong can utilize his strength to interact with the environment, building, destroying, and riding boulders. The game emphasizes exploration, with hidden items scattered throughout the land.
The game supports two-player co-op and utilizes the Nintendo Switch 2’s mouse control. It is also GameShare and GameChat compatible.

“Donkey Kong Bananza” is priced at £66.99 for the physical edition and £58.99 for the digital version.
